Guests also ask:

Common AHAs used include mandelic acid, lactic acid and polyhydroxy acids. One cream specifically lists a 1.25% lactic acid concentration.

They are most commonly labeled for normal and sensitive skin; several listings also recommend them for dry and mature skin.

Product warnings commonly note that AHAs can be skin irritants. Some formulas also highlight dermatologist or gynecologist approval and hypoallergenic design for sensitive skin.

Serum roll-ons instruct applying generously to the underarms and allowing about 30–60 seconds to dry. Reviewers note serum formats can require a brief absorption time and may feel temporarily sticky.
